Early Voting at City Hall
Absentee (early) Voting in the State of Maine Room begins the week of
October 11th, 2016 from 9:00 AM - 4:30 PM Monday-Friday. Absentee voting ends on
Thursday, November 3rd, 2016. On November 3 only, voting will remain open until 7:00 PM.

Register to Vote
If you would like to
register to vote you may do so at the City Clerk’s Office in Room 203 here in City Hall. Portland residents may also register to vote on election day at their polling location.
